So the event posters are super fun. Same 1943 roadster as the shirt, same reason. This time sitting in a field of grass that’s slightly reminiscent of  a brain, a jungle, a trap and a swirling release. Spinning off the wheels are again the fractals of LSD molecules. Around the outside of the poster are the words from Albert Hoffman himself, written in his journal from that fateful day in April 1943 when upon ingesting 250 mics of LSD-25 he rode his bike home and sent the rest of us forward….

These posters are 12″ x 18″, matte finish, blacklight phosphoresence, 40 each color, S/N by artist Erin Cadigan.
